Aggrieved NPP supporters attack I.C. Quaye

"There is something enigmatic about Alhaji Inusah Issaka," comments The Accra Mail, which says also that "whenever he sets his foot on the political landscape, there is trouble." Even though he has asked to be brought back to his mother party the NPP, there is already confusion about his sudden, about-turn. In the NDC where he had a brief sojourn, party stalwarts point accusing fingers at him as the cause of the group's poor showing in the last elections.

Party supporters and sympathizers of the NPP have stormed the office and house of the Greater Accra Regional Minister, Sheikh I.C. Quaye, requesting that Inusah should be snubbed with some threatening that they would advised themselves if the 'traitor' is accepted back to the NPP fold.

Meanwhile, Madam Hawa Yakubu who was sympathetic to Inusah's move and asked that he be accepted has attracted the opprobrium of a cross section of the NPP top hierarchy. An MP in a telephone chat with the paper, cautioned the party managers to be wary of NDC maneuvers to destabilize the NPP through Inusah.
